The City of Dunwoody will be hosting the first of four community meeting to discuss the Dunwoody Village area on Tuesday, September 21, 2010 at 7:00 p.m. at Dunwoody Baptist Chapel which is located at 1445 Mount Vernon Road, Dunwoody, GA 30338. The meeting is part of the development of a Master Plan for the Dunwoody Village area, which will provide a framework to guide land use, transportation, and open space improvements in the future. At this kickoff meeting, we will be presenting the market analysis of the area as well as an interactive visual preference survey to help identify key goals and requirements for the future.
